Can you run Gazebo on Windows?

Currently, only the Ubuntu distribution is supported. OS X is currently not supported. Windows currently not supported.

How do I install a Gazebo source?

Build
  1. Make sure you’re at the source code root directory: cd ~/code/gazebo.
  2. Make a build directory and go there mkdir build cd build.
  3. Configure and build. …
  4. Once that’s done, install Gazebo: sudo make install.
  5. Now you can try your installation: gazebo –verbose.

How do I install a Gazebo model?

Run Gazebo
  1. Install Gazebo.
  2. Open a terminal. On most Ubuntu systems you can press CTRL+ALT+t.
  3. Start Gazebo by entering the following at the command prompt. gazebo. Note: The first time you launch gazebo, it will try to download a couple of models so this process may take some time.

What is the difference between RVIZ and Gazebo?

The difference between the two can be summed up in the following excerpt from Morgan Quigley (one of the original developers of ROS) in his book Programming Robots with ROS: “rviz shows you what the robot thinks is happening, while Gazebo shows you what is really happening.”

What is gazebo plugin?

Overview of Gazebo Plugins

A plugin is a chunk of code that is compiled as a shared library and inserted into the simulation. The plugin has direct access to all the functionality of Gazebo through the standard C++ classes. Plugins are useful because they: let developers control almost any aspect of Gazebo.

How do I use ROS on Windows?

ROS is currently not supported on Windows, but it is possible to run parts of ROS on Windows. In particular, you can: run some of the Python code, including the ROS client library for Python (rospy). This is useful, for example, if you need to interface a process on Windows with a ROS graph running elsewhere.

How does gazebo work?

Gazebo is a 3D dynamic simulator with the ability to accurately and efficiently simulate populations of robots in complex indoor and outdoor environments. While similar to game engines, Gazebo offers physics simulation at a much higher degree of fidelity, a suite of sensors, and interfaces for both users and programs.

What is RVIZ used for?

Visualizing Sensor Data with rviz. rviz is a powerful robot visualization tool. It provides a convenient GUI to visualize sensor data, robot models, environment maps, which is useful for developing and debugging your robot controllers.

What is a URDF file?

The URDF (Universal Robot Description Format) model is a collection of files that describe a robot’s physical description to ROS. These files are used by a program called ROS (Robot Operating System) to tell the computer what the robot actually looks like in real life.
